WebDiabetes (AKA diabetes mellitus) refers to a problem with regulating blood sugar (glucose). Insulin helps the body to use glucose for energy, and store the rest. Diabetic cats either don't produce enough insulin or have a resistance to it. There are two main types - type I and type II. Type I diabetes is rare in cats, type II is far more common.
